REYNOLDS, James.

Reynolds's New Map of London and Its Suburbs.

The Map is divided into Quarter Mile Sections for Measuring Distances. The Letters N.W. &c. indicate the Postal Districts.

Stock Code 115377

London, James Reynolds & Sons, 174 Strand, 1879.

A lovely example of Reynolds's Victorian map of London highlighting the train lines and train stations, showing the precedent for train and public transport centred maps before the advent of the tube.

Coloured lithograph plan, dissected into 40 sections and mounted on linen, extending west to east from Hammersmith to River Lea and north to south from Holloway to Brixton, original red covers, discoloured, gilt letters to upper cover. Overall size: 68cm by 101.5cm.

Hyde 114 10; Boyle 286.
